CO₂ Extraction: The Industry Favorite with a Learning Curve

CO₂ extraction is widely considered the gold standard in cannabis processing. It is used by large-scale manufacturers, craft producers, and medical formulators alike. While it takes a serious investment to run properly, the results are often worth it. 

This method is known for delivering clean, safe, and consistent cannabinoid extracts that meet the demands of both regulators and consumers.

How It Works and Why It’s Popular

CO₂ becomes a supercritical fluid when it is exposed to a precise combination of temperature and pressure. In this state, it acts like a gas and a liquid at the same time, which allows it to move through plant material and dissolve desirable compounds with high selectivity. 

Operators can adjust variables like pressure or temperature to target specific cannabinoids and terpenes, which gives this method an edge in precision.

This process leaves behind no solvent residue, which makes it especially appealing for wellness products and full-spectrum tinctures. Because the CO₂ is recycled in a closed-loop system, it is also seen as one of the more sustainable choices in the extraction world.

What Users Love and What They Watch For

Customers often appreciate CO₂-extracted products for their clean flavor and smooth feel. They tend to be less harsh on the throat and more neutral in taste, which appeals to those who use cannabis for therapeutic reasons.

That said, there are cases where CO₂ extracts can come across as bland or flat. This usually happens when terpenes are stripped away during processing or lost in post-extraction refinement. 

Terpenes are fragile compounds, and without careful handling, even the cleanest extract can lose some of its original complexity. Brands that understand this build their process around terpene preservation, not just potency.

Ethanol Extraction: Old School, Fast, and Surprisingly Controversial

Ethanol extraction has been around for decades and remains one of the most accessible methods in the industry. It is quick, scalable, and relatively inexpensive compared to other systems, which makes it a popular choice among both large processors and craft producers. 

While it is praised for its efficiency, this method also comes with some trade-offs that deserve attention.

How It Works and Why It Is Scalable

In this method, food-grade ethanol is poured over cannabis to dissolve cannabinoids and terpenes into a liquid solution. The temperature of the solvent plays a huge role in the outcome. 

Cold ethanol tends to preserve more delicate compounds like terpenes while minimizing the extraction of chlorophyll and waxes. Warm ethanol speeds up the process but can pull out more unwanted plant material, which often requires post-processing steps like winterization or filtration.

Because ethanol is classified as a Class 3 solvent and is widely approved for food and pharmaceutical use, it is considered safe when used correctly. The process is also easy to repeat, which helps manufacturers maintain consistent cannabinoid profiles across product batches.

Taste, Testing, and Chlorophyll Concerns

One of the biggest complaints with ethanol-extracted products is the taste. Some tinctures or oils carry a bitter, grassy note that can linger. This is almost always a result of warm ethanol extraction or improper filtration, both of which allow chlorophyll to make its way into the final product.

A common concern from customers is seeing a dark green tint in their tincture and wondering if it is safe or properly made. Cold extraction with proper filtration usually solves this issue. 

Still, it highlights the importance of working with brands that disclose their process and perform full panel testing, including residual solvent analysis.

Butane Extraction (BHO): Flavor Bomb or Fire Hazard?

Butane extraction, often referred to as BHO, is a favorite among concentrate enthusiasts for one main reason. It delivers flavor. This method preserves terpenes like few others can, which makes it ideal for dabs, wax, and live resin products. 

The results are often potent, aromatic, and fast-acting. However, the process behind it is not without serious concerns, especially when safety and quality are on the line.

How It Works and What It Creates

Butane is a hydrocarbon solvent that quickly strips cannabinoids and terpenes from plant material. The process involves saturating the cannabis with butane to dissolve the active compounds, then purging the solvent out using a combination of heat and vacuum pressure. 

What is left behind is a dense, sticky concentrate packed with cannabinoids and a full spectrum of flavor compounds.

Products made with this method include shatter, wax, budder, and live resin. These concentrates are typically vaporized or dabbed and are favored by users looking for quick relief and rich taste. When made correctly in a closed-loop system by trained professionals, BHO can be clean and consistent.

Risks at Home and In Your Lungs

The biggest danger with butane extraction is in the wrong hands. It is highly flammable and not safe for home setups or open systems. Even small leaks during processing can lead to fire or explosion, which is why licensed labs follow strict safety protocols.

Another common issue comes down to product quality. If the butane used is not properly distilled, or if the purging step is rushed, traces of solvent can remain in the final concentrate. This can lead to a harsh taste or even health risks over time. 

Water Extraction (Bubble Hash): Pure, Hands-On, and Terpene-Rich

For those who value purity above all else, water extraction stands out as one of the cleanest ways to separate cannabinoids and terpenes from the cannabis plant. This method relies on nothing but cold water, ice, and agitation to isolate trichomes. 

It is a completely solvent-free process, which makes it a favorite among traditionalists and health-conscious users alike.

How It Works and Why Purists Love It

The process begins by soaking cannabis in ice water. As the plant is gently stirred or shaken, the trichomes, the small, crystal-like glands that contain most of the cannabinoids and terpenes, become brittle from the cold and fall away from the plant material. 

These are then filtered through a series of mesh bags, each with a different micron size, to separate the resin glands from any plant debris.

What remains is a soft, sandy concentrate known as bubble hash. Depending on the grade, this can be smoked directly, vaporized, or pressed into rosin. Since there are no chemical solvents involved, the flavor and aroma of the original flower often come through in a noticeable way. 

Many experienced users find water-extracted hash offers a deeper and more nuanced profile than many modern concentrates.

DIY Troubles and Frozen Flower Tips

Despite its appeal, water extraction can be difficult to master at home. The technique is labor-intensive and requires patience. One of the biggest challenges is drying the hash properly. If it is not dried in a cool, low-humidity environment, moisture can get trapped inside and lead to mold. 

Using freshly frozen flower can improve yield and terpene retention, but it also requires careful handling to avoid contamination or breakdown of delicate compounds.

Rosin Pressing: No Solvents, Just Pressure and Heat

Rosin pressing is a favorite among those who want total control over what goes into their concentrate. It is a mechanical process that uses heat and pressure to extract oil from cannabis flower or hash. 

There are no chemicals involved and no solvents to purge, which makes this one of the cleanest options available. Rosin may not be the most efficient method on a large scale, but for many users, it strikes the right balance between simplicity and quality.

How It Works and What You Get

The process starts with high pressure and carefully applied heat. Flower or bubble hash is placed between parchment paper and pressed using heated plates. As the pressure increases, the resin glands burst and release their oils, which are collected and cooled into a soft, golden extract.

This method produces a full-spectrum concentrate that retains more of the plant’s natural terpenes. It also tends to offer a more flavorful and immediate effect, especially when the starting material is top quality. 

Rosin is commonly used for dabbing, but it can also be added to joints, vapes, or even edibles. Because it is solvent-free, it appeals to people who want a more natural experience without compromising potency.

Home Pressing Realities

While rosin pressing can be done at home, it is not always efficient. The yield is highly dependent on the quality of the material. Well-cured, trichome-rich flower or high-grade hash will produce much better results than dry or stemmy product. 

Some users compare rosin to distillate and prefer its richer terpene profile, even if it is less refined. For those who care more about flavor and experience than lab-grade potency, rosin offers something that feels closer to the original plant.

Which Extraction Method Is Best for Each Cannabinoid?

Different cannabinoids respond better to different extraction techniques. Some are easy to isolate using traditional solvents, while others require more targeted or delicate handling. 

The structure, stability, and concentration of each cannabinoid all affect how efficiently it can be extracted. If the wrong method is used, purity and yield can suffer, and the final product may not deliver the results you are looking for.

Here is a quick breakdown of the most commonly extracted cannabinoids and the methods that work best for each one:

Cannabinoid

Recommended Extraction Method

Why It Works

CBD

CO₂, Ethanol

High purity and scalable across product formats

THC

BHO, Rosin

Preserves potency and terpenes for dabbing

THCa

Water Hash followed by Rosin

Solventless approach that retains full spectrum

CBG

CO₂, Ethanol

Allows for targeted isolation of minor compounds

CBC

CO₂, Chromatography after extraction

Precision required due to lower concentrations

Choosing the right method does not just improve efficiency behind the scenes. It shapes the final product, from flavor to effect to how your body absorbs it. That is why reputable brands invest in the right systems and test rigorously to ensure quality across every batch.

Can You Do Cannabis Extraction at Home?

Home extraction is possible, but not all methods are well suited for it. While some techniques are safe and relatively easy to manage, others carry serious safety risks or deliver poor results. 

For those who want to explore the process at home, it is essential to understand what works, what to avoid, and where to draw the line between curiosity and chemistry.

DIY Extraction Methods That Can Work

Certain extraction methods are simple enough for personal use without needing lab-grade equipment. These tend to be solventless or use food-safe materials and can still produce decent results with the right inputs.

  • Rosin Press: Uses heated plates and pressure to extract oil from flower or hash. Produces clean, solvent-free rosin with strong flavor and fast onset. Small desktop presses are affordable and beginner-friendly.

  • Dry Ice Kief: A mechanical method that uses dry ice and mesh bags to knock trichomes off frozen flower. Yields are small but can be great for making homemade edibles or capsules.

  • Cold Ethanol: Requires freezing both the ethanol and the cannabis to avoid pulling out chlorophyll. Proper ventilation is essential, and the process must include filtering and evaporation steps to remove residual solvent.

What to Avoid Unless You Are a Pro

Other methods may look simple on paper but carry serious hazards or fail to produce consistent, clean extracts.

  • Butane or Propane Extraction: These gases are highly flammable and dangerous to handle without closed-loop systems and lab controls. Open-blasting at home is illegal and unsafe.

  • Microwave Extraction: Often promoted as quick and easy, but results vary wildly and may damage cannabinoids or terpenes. There is little control and almost no consistency.

If you are exploring extraction at home, start with food-grade ethanol or invest in a small rosin press. Clean inputs, careful technique, and proper safety practices are the key to success.
